#af664d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#af664d is composed of 68.6% red, 40%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.7% magenta, 56%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 15.3 degrees, a saturation of 38.9% and a lightness of 49.4%. #af664d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cc9a with #5f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#af664d color description : Dark moderate orange.
#af664d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#af664d has RGB values of R:175, G:102,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.42, Y:0.56,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11494989.
